TDI Nitrox Instructor
This is the course for Instructors
wishing to teach Enriched Air Nitrox (EANx) as a breathing gas. If open
water dives are included, the maximum depth is
not to exceed the skill level of the Instructor.
The objectives of this course are to train Instructors
in the benefits, hazards, and proper procedures
for teaching EANx 22 to EANx 40.
Course Structure :
2 days (one day theory – one day diving)
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
TDI Advanced Nitrox Instructor
This is the instructor level certification
wishing to teach Enriched course for Instructors wishing to teach the use of EANx
21 through 100% oxygen for optimal mixes to a
depth of 40 metres. The object of this course
is to train Nitrox Instructors to teach the benefits,
hazards and proper procedures for EANx 21 through
100% oxygen for dives not requiring staged decompression,
multi level dives using gas switches to extend the NDL.
Course Structure :
3 days (one day theory - two days diving)
5 days if combined with TDI decompression Procedures Instructor
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
TDI Decompression Procedures Instructor
This course examines
the theory, methods and procedures of planned
stage decompression diving. This program is designed
as a stand-alone course or it may be taught in
conjunction with such courses as Advanced Nitrox
Instructor, Advanced Wreck Instructor, or Extended
Range Instructor. The objective of this course
is to train Instructors how to plan and conduct
a standard decompression procedures course not
to exceed a maximum depth of 45 metres. The most
common equipment requirements, gear set-ups, deco-techniques
and decompression mixtures are covered. Students
are permitted to utilize Enriched Air Nitrox mixes
or oxygen for decompression provided the gas mix
is within their current Nitrox certification level.
Course Structure :
3 days (one day theory – two days diving)
5 days if combined with TDI Advanced Nitrox Instructor
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
TDI Extended Range Instructor
This course provides
the training and experience required to be certified
to competently teach air dives to 55 metres that
require staged decompression, utilizing Nitrox
mixtures or oxygen during decompression. The objective
of this course is to train Instructors in the
proper techniques, equipment requirements, and
hazards of deep air diving to a maximum of 55
metres and utilizing Nitrox mixtures or oxygen
for staged decompression.
Course Structure :
5 days (plus one full assist)
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
TDI Trimix Instructor
The TDI Trimix Instructor
Course provides the training required to competently
and safely teach breathing gases containing helium
for dives that require staged decompression to
a maximum depth of 60 metres. The objective of
this course is to train Instructors to teach the
benefits, hazards and proper procedures of utilizing
custom oxygen/helium/nitrogen mixtures as breathing
gases containing no less than 18% Oxygen.
Course Structure :
5 days
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ses

TDI Drager Dolphin SCR Instructor
This is the Instructor
level certification course for Instructors wishing
to teach the Draeger Nitrox semi-closed circuit
Rebreather course. The objective of this course
is to train Instructors to teach recreational
Nitrox Rebreather diving, and to develop basic
Rebreather diving skills appropriate to diving
within the normal recreational depth limits for
no-decompression diving.
Course Structure :
3 days (one day theory – two days diving)
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
TDI TDI Evolution Air Diluent CCR Instructor
This is the Instructor
level certification course for Instructors wishing
to teach the Ambient Pressure Evolution Closed
Circuit Rebreather course. The objective of this
course is to train Instructors to teach recreational
Rebreather diving, and to develop basic rebreather
diving skills appropriate to diving within the
normal recreational depth limits for minimum decompression
diving to 40 metres using oxygen and an air diluent.
Course Structure :
3 days (one day theory - two days diving)
Pre-requisites apply to all instructor level courses
